What are the common treatment approaches for Stage 4 hepatocellular carcinoma?

Stage 4 hepatocellular carcinoma treatment focuses on systemic therapies to control tumor spread and extend survival. Primary approaches include immunotherapy combinations and targeted oral drugs. Ukrainian oncology centers like Dobrobut Medical Network utilize ISO-certified protocols to provide comprehensive diagnostic staging and palliative care.

  • Systemic therapy: Immunotherapy combinations like atezolizumab with bevacizumab serve as first-line options.
  • Targeted drugs: Oral medications such as sorafenib or lenvatinib target specific cancer cell markers.
  • Locoregional management: Embolization or radiation therapy helps manage localized symptoms and liver-dominant disease.
  • Advanced diagnostics: Abdominal CT scans and chest imaging confirm the extent of distant metastasis.

Patient Consensus: Patients emphasize that liver function and fitness levels are critical when choosing between multiple lines of treatment. Many suggest asking specifically about BCLC staging and managing symptoms like fatigue or appetite loss early in the process.
